Cereals allocated to food, animal feed and fuel in Ghana
Ghana: Cereals allocated to food, animal feed and fuel was 1.35 million tonnes in 2023. ◆ Volatile
Cereals allocated to food, animal feed and fuel in Ghana, 1961–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(2025) –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in tonnes.
Analysis
In 2023, cereals allocated to food, animal feed and fuel in Ghana stood at 1.35 million tonnes. That is the highest value across all 63 years on record.
The figure is up 3.5% on the previous year and up 67,250.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, cereals allocated to food, animal feed and fuel in Ghana peaked at 1.35 million tonnes in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0 tonnes, in 1961.
Ghana ranks 21st of 180 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Quantity of cereal crops allocated to other uses (and not to human food or animal feed), predominantly industrial uses such as biofuel production.
